HOLD A MEETING WITH THE EMBASSY OF THE COMMONWEALTH OF AUSTRALIA TO MONGOLIA

   As part of its efforts to strengthen its participation in the regional maritime sector, in 2018, the Mongolia Maritime Administration (MMA) has become a member of the Asia-Pacific Heads of Maritime Safety Agencies (APHoMSA) which is one of the key and influential international community in the region and headquartered in the Commonwealth of Australia. During the 20th session held in Seoul, Republic of Korea in 2019, the members agreed on Mongolia’s offer to host the 23rd session of APHoMSA in 2023.

   Accordingly, MMA hold an official meeting with delegations from Australian embassy in order to discuss about the collaborative host of 23rd APHomSA with the Australian Maritime Safety Administration (AMSA) which is planned to be held in Sydney, Commonwealth of Australia, from June 5th to 9th, 2023. 

   The meeting were attended by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Commonwealth of Australia to Mongolia, Mrs. Katie Smith and other delegations from two organizations.

   During the meeting MMA has presented an introduction on policy and operations of Mongolia in maritime sector, mentioning the importance of cooperating with the Commonwealth of Australia is a significant matter to Mongolia for the successful fulfillment of its flag state obligation, expressing its willingness to conclude a Memorandum of Understanding on cooperation with the AMSA during the upcoming APHoMSA session, and handed over the draft of the MOU. 

   The Ambassador praised Mongolia's successful operations in the maritime sector, despite being a landlocked country, and expressed that she would pay attention to and support the expansion of cooperation in the maritime sector of the two countries in the future.
